Deputy head of the Samaria Regional Council, Dvidi Ben Zion, defended Central Command chief Maj. Gen. Avi Blot on Kol B'Rama radio Monday morning, calling him the best OC Central Command the settlement movement has had in 20 years. Ben Zion praised Blot's character and his support for both conventional settlements and farm outposts.
The comment by Ben Zion, a senior figure in the Samaria Regional Council, adds to a wave of public backing for Maj. Gen. Blot as the controversy over his tenure continues. The Zioneer has reported over the past week that several Likud MKs and local council heads have criticized Defense Minister Israel Katz's campaign to replace Blot, praising the general's counter-terror record and his work with communities in Judea and Samaria. Ben Zion's remarks specifically highlighted Blot's support for farm outposts, a sensitive issue in the region.
